Counselling for Rehabilitation of Internal Displaced Individual: Post Crisis Interaction and Recovery
Résumé
This research focuses on counselling for Rehabilitation of internal displaced individuals, Post crisis interaction and recovery (IDPs) in Nigeria. The thriving concept of this study is the counselling that bring about wholesome rehabilitation with positive self-concept among internal displaced individuals in IDPs. The paper identifies the grave challenges faced by the displaced persons, points out the importance of counselling as part of measures to assist IDPs and the role of key stakeholders such as civil society organisations (CSO) and Educational Intuitions; governmental and non-governmental organizations. Thus, the challenges facing IDPs needs a collaborative effort in ameliorating their plight. Therefore , this paper discusses the Concept of Internally Displaced Persons (IDPs), Challenges facing the Internally Displaced Persons (IDPs) in Nigeria, The Role of Stakeholders in Tackling the Challenges of IDPs in Nigeria and Implication of the challenges for Counselling.
